Table of Contents

Class PromotionScheduleModel

Namespace
Kentico.Xperience.Admin.DigitalCommerce.UIPages
Assembly
Kentico.Xperience.Admin.DigitalCommerce.dll

Promotion schedule model.

public class PromotionScheduleModel
Inheritance
object
PromotionScheduleModel
Extension Methods

Constructors

PromotionScheduleModel()

public PromotionScheduleModel()

Properties

PromotionActiveFrom

Promotion active from.

[DateTimeInputComponent(Label = "{$digitalcommerce.promotions.edit.schedule.activefrom$}", Order = 1)]
[RequiredValidationRule]
public DateTime? PromotionActiveFrom { get; set; }

Property Value

DateTime?

PromotionActiveTo

Promotion active to.

[DateTimeInputComponent(Label = "{$digitalcommerce.promotions.edit.schedule.activeto$}", Order = 3)]
[VisibleIfTrue("SetEndDate")]
[RequiredValidationRule]
public DateTime? PromotionActiveTo { get; set; }

Property Value

DateTime?

SetEndDate

Set end date.

[CheckBoxComponent(Label = "{$digitalcommerce.promotions.edit.schedule.setenddate$}", Order = 2)]
public bool SetEndDate { get; set; }

Property Value

bool